A leading international law firm is seeking a qualified lawyer to join its London-based compliance team, focusing on financial crime across their global offices.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ead the financial crime function within the compliance team
  • Advise on anti-money laundering (AML), sanctions, bribery, fraud, tax evasion and market abuse
  • Support the MLRO with SARs and regulatory questionnaires
  • Monitor regulatory changes and update internal policies and procedures
  • Maintain AML records and databases
  • Prepare for audits and liaise with regulators
  • Approve high-risk clients and matters
  • Deliver training and represent the firm at industry events
  • Manage and mentor compliance staff
  • Provide advice on conflicts, confidentiality, client terms, secondments, and regulatory codes
  • Support with insurance renewals and other compliance projects

Requirements:

  • Qualified lawyer with 5+ years PQE
  • Experience in an international firm
  • Strong knowledge of UK and EU financial crime laws and regulations
  • Proven experience in advising on financial crime and submitting SARs
